Pradesh Congress Committee president and Ludhiana MP Amrinder Singh Raja Warring on Thursday said the Rahul Gandhi’s statement during his visit to the US had been misinterpreted.
He said Rahul Gandhi engaged in a conversation with a Sikh individual in America, inquiring about his name. During the discussion, Gandhi remarked on the unfortunate reality that, due to the prevailing political climate in India, Sikhs and Sardars might feel the need to seek permission before openly representing their religion by tying a turban or wearing a “kara”.
“Rahul Gandhi was highlighting the underlying fear that has crept into various religions due to the divisive politics perpetuated by the BJP,” Warring said.
